<p><strong><span class="legendSpanClass">MENLO PARK</span></strong> &#8212; Meta Platforms &#8212; parent company of Facebook, Instagram and Whatsapp &#8212; announced that its Class A common stock will begin trading on NASDAQ under the ticker symbol &#8216;META&#8217; prior to market open on June 9, 2022.</p>
<p>This will replace the company&#8217;s current ticker symbol &#8216;FB&#8217;, which has been used since its initial public offering in 2012. The new ticker symbol aligns with the company&#8217;s rebranding from Facebook to Meta, announced on October 28, 2021.</p>
<p>CEO Mark Zuckerberg rebranded the company to focus on the metaverse, which he believes will be a prominent platform of the future Internet.</p>
<p>The move to change its stock symbol took over eight months to complete. It&#8217;s rare for such a large company to change its name and stock symbol. Meta was the eight-highest stock based on market capitalization with a value of $516 billion. The stock was down Friday 4% and down 43% for the year.</p>
